A spiral conduit serves as a durable and flexible protective channel for cables, wiring systems, and piping. Its key functions include:
Mechanical Protection: Shields sensitive cables and hoses from impact, vibration, and abrasion.
Environmental Resistance: Prevents exposure to dust, water, chemicals, and extreme temperatures.
Structural Integrity: Reinforces systems that require rigid or semi-flexible pathways.
Cable Management: Provides organized routing, especially in complex industrial installations.
In dynamic systems, such as moving machine arms or high-vibration zones, spiral conduits ensure that internal components are protected while still allowing mobility. In static systems—like buried infrastructure or overhead power lines—they serve as long-term shielding solutions.

Standard Spiral Conduits: Constructed from galvanized or stainless steel, these conduits offer basic protection and are used in general industrial applications.
Coated Spiral Conduits: These are covered with PVC, PE, or polyurethane coatings for additional resistance to corrosion, chemicals, and weathering. Coated spiral conduits are ideal for outdoor and corrosive environments.
Heavy-Duty Spiral Conduits: Designed for high-impact and load-bearing applications such as mining, construction machinery, and shipbuilding.
Flexible Spiral Conduits: Used in moving parts, robotic arms, and flexible cable systems where directional movement is required.
Fire-Resistant Spiral Conduits: Engineered to maintain integrity under extreme heat, suitable for railways, tunnels, and energy facilities.
Each of these spiral conduit types can be produced in different diameters, wall thicknesses, and coating materials, depending on project-specific needs. Customization includes inner lining, color coding, UV-resistance, and anti-static features.
Spiral conduits are essential components in a wide range of industries where durability, safety, and performance are non-negotiable. Some of the major application areas include:
Electrical Infrastructure: Cable protection in substations, switchgear, and distribution systems.
Industrial Machinery: Routing of control cables, hydraulic hoses, and pneumatic lines in dynamic equipment.
Automotive and Railway Systems: Used in harness protection, signal lines, and onboard electrical systems exposed to vibration and weather.
Construction and Civil Engineering: Embedded in concrete or installed above ground to guide power and data lines in large-scale developments.
Energy and Utilities: In oil & gas, wind turbines, and solar farms where long-lasting, corrosion-resistant spiral pipe systems are required.
Marine and Offshore: For applications in ships, docks, and offshore platforms that demand saltwater and chemical resistance.
In each case, the use of spiral conduits improves the operational lifespan of systems, reduces maintenance costs, and enhances overall safety.
